Holocaust survivor and Olympic champion Agnes Keleti dies

  • Five-time Olympic gold medalist in gymnastics Agnes Keleti has died at the age of 103. Until her death, Keleti, who survived the Holocaust in her native Hungary, was the oldest living Olympic champion.

Agnes Keleti, a Holocaust survivor and one of the most decorated female Olympic gymnasts, passed away at the age of 100. Born in Budapest in 1921, Keleti survived the Holocaust by hiding in a convent and later in a safe house. After World War II, she resumed her gymnastics career, winning 10 Olympic medals, including five golds, at the 1952 Helsinki and 1956 Melbourne Olympics. Her achievements include gold medals in floor exercise, balance beam, and uneven bars, among others. Keleti's life story is one of resilience and triumph, having overcome the atrocities of the Holocaust to become an Olympic legend. She later moved to Israel, where she continued to influence gymnastics as a coach.
